Cardano’s ADA cryptocurrency experienced a notable surge, pushing its value above the $0.60 mark. This positive price movement was largely driven by Charles Hoskinson’s outspoken views on U.S. crypto policy. Hoskinson, a co-founder of Ethereum and a key figure behind Cardano, has been a vocal advocate for a favorable regulatory environment for cryptocurrencies in the United States. His influence and standing within the cryptocurrency community have the power to sway market sentiments, as was observed with ADA’s recent rally. However, despite this positive momentum, there are emerging signals within the market that suggest ADA may face difficulties in maintaining its current level.
The rise of ADA over the $0.60 threshold was seen by many investors as a bullish sign, especially in the context of the broader cryptocurrency market, which has been navigating through a period of uncertainty and volatility. The enthusiasm around Hoskinson’s commentary on U.S. crypto policies underscores the market’s sensitivity to regulatory news and its potential impact on cryptocurrency values. Hoskinson’s position highlights a broader narrative within the crypto space regarding the need for clear and supportive regulatory frameworks that can foster growth and innovation while protecting investors.
Nevertheless, market analysts are cautioning investors about a potential pullback for ADA. Technical indicators are pointing towards overbought conditions, suggesting that the recent rally might have been too rapid and could lead to a corrective pullback. Furthermore, the overall sentiment in the crypto markets remains cautious, with investors closely monitoring regulatory developments, economic signals, and technological advancements within the blockchain sector. This cautious sentiment is compounded by broader economic factors affecting investment appetites, including inflation rates, interest rates, and geopolitical tensions, which could impact the risk tolerance of investors in the cryptocurrency space.
Looking ahead, ADA’s ability to maintain its $0.60 level will likely depend on several factors, including broader market trends, ongoing regulatory developments, and Cardano’s own technological advancements and ecosystem growth. For investors, closely monitoring these factors will be essential in navigating the volatile world of cryptocurrency investing. While the support from influential figures like Charles Hoskinson provides a positive outlook for Cardano, the complex interplay of market dynamics and regulatory landscapes will continue to pose challenges and opportunities for ADA and the broader cryptocurrency market.
